The Chartered Institute of Payroll Professionals (CIPP) originated in 1980 when the Association of Payroll and Superannuation Administrators (APSA) was formed. Its main aims are to advance payroll and pension professionalism in the UK by promoting high standards through education, training, membership, and industry recognition. CIPP represents payroll professionals to government and regulatory bodies, ensuring their interests are voiced, and sets best practice standards in payroll, pensions, and automatic enrolment.
The Global Payroll Alliance (GPA) was founded as an official body in December 2014. Its main aims are to support payroll professionals worldwide by providing comprehensive resources, expert-led training, networking events, and directories focused on global and in-country payroll. GPA serves as a central hub for education, industry updates, and standards, enabling knowledge sharing and helping payroll, HR, and finance professionals navigate complex international payroll challenges.
